Northeastern Fern Identifier

Description: Richard Mitchell, formerly a State Botanist at the New York State Museum, has developed a computerized identification aid to allow just about anyone to correctly identify ferns. Dr. Mitchell has completed this identifier, titled Northeastern Fern Identifier, and it is currently being sold at the New York State Museum Shop. Visit Publications and Shops for ordering or purchase information. (Please note that the published version of this program is not useable on most newer computers due to changes in video cards. It generally only runs on older computers that originally ran Windows98, Windows95/NT, or Windows 3.x. Due to this compatibility issue the CDs are being sold at a discounted price.) Published in 1998.
